Clear signal
Solved a subtle digital noise issue in my signal chain.
I have two pedals daisy-chained with a single 9V 1,5A power supply. Both of them have digital processing and every time one of them was engaged and activated the small digital screen, a subtle but still noticeable digital noise could be heard.
Using this noise blocker in one of the pedals supply chain was the solution I was looking for.

Simple and works well
I used this to eliminate high-frequency oscillation in a pedalboard where an analog OD and delay pedals were daisy chained to a same power supply with a digital tuner pedal. When connecting the tuner 9V via the Joyo ZGP the oscillation was gone.

Works as expexted
I daisy chain an HX Stomp and 3-4 analog pedals from a single power supply. I have a two output daisy chain, one end going to the Stomp, the other, through the ZGP Noise Blocker onto the daisy chain for the analog pedals. This prevents the noise digital pedals sometimes induce in the circuit.
